Output 5930d851e51b59bea4001a52f9b15143665225c4a7170a705bdaeb81b093dc6a:0

value
525960018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587548e582063a8c5fe48b26a229b47d21f29f8f OP_EQUAL
address
39kjtWfWT1RVqwbnSr8AjNfSUTQLvE7WQ6
transaction
5930d851e51b59bea4001a52f9b15143665225c4a7170a705bdaeb81b093dc6a
spent
true